09:14 — BinRoute optimizer at the Valdemar fulfilment hub began serving pick lists sorted by an unauthenticated override flag. Flag originated from a debug endpoint left reachable after the Q3 hardening pass. 09:27 — endpoint disabled at the edge. 09:40 — audit of request logs showed no external exploitation; all overrides came from an internal load tester. No inventory data left the perimeter. Full diff and exposure window are attached for security review, keyed to the trace token below.

trace token, fafog-kageg: htk4_98e6

## Turnstile Upgrade — Main Lobby, Corvane Plaza

Heads up, contractors: the old swipe turnstiles in the Corvane Plaza lobby are being replaced this month. While the work's ongoing, only the far-left gate is operational, so expect a bit of a queue around 9am. Your usual visitor passes won't scan on the temporary gate. Instead, punch in at the small keypad on the gate post using this code.

door code, fawef-faduf: bdg-JVUCQ-8

Handover Note — Commission Scheme

Welcome aboard! The revised commission scheme for the Ardlow product range goes live next quarter. Accelerators now kick in at 85% of quota, not 100%, which the reps love. Payroll mapping is done; comms draft is with Renna. One sensitive item to flag before you announce anything, noted below.

internal memo for hahaf-kahof: Only 39 of the 428 pilot accounts renewed Sorion, so a churn review is set for April 12. Praokix Freight is in early talks to buy Queniusox Group for about $145.8 million.

## Deployment

Cold starts remain the primary risk during a Lanternfold release. Each handler is pre-warmed by the scheduler for five minutes after rollout, and traffic is shifted gradually so that no region serves cold instances above two percent. Please verify the warm-pool dashboard before approving promotion to production. The deployment pipeline reads the warming parameters from the configuration shown immediately below this paragraph:

settings of bafof-fajog:
[aldix]
port = 9300
region = north-3
host = aldix.kelvilabs.example
team = istath
timeout_ms = 1500
retries = 8